Band biography
Halcyon Way photo
The progressive metal band Halcyon Way was formed in Atlanta, Georgia, in 2001 by song writer and producer Jon Bodan. The band spent some time on the local live circuit playing with acts such as Samael, Strapping Young Lad, Cathedral and Helloween. A record deal with the Texas based Christian metal label Bombworks Records was signed in early April 2006 and the band's debut album "A Manifesto For Domination" was set for a summer release. However, nothing ever materialized from this deal for undisclosed reasons.

In September 2008 a new contract was signed with US based Nightmare Records for a November release of the long delayed debut album. The CD was produced by band leader Jon Bodan, mixed by Lasse Lammert (Alestorm) and mastered by James Murphy (Testament, Death). It also featured guest appearances from Jonah Weingarten of Pyramaze and Blaze Pearson of The Souls Unrest.

In July 2009 Halcyon Way performed at the Rocklahoma Festival in Pryor, Oklahoma. Early September 2009 saw the band parting ways with frontman Sean Shields due to creative differences, being replaced by Steve Braun of Italian progressive metallers Ashent.
